RGBJunkie-Deck plugin
RGBJunkie ships a companion Stream Deck plugin you install separately from the desktop app.
- Download RGBJunkie-Deck from the GitHub releases page (zip includes the compiled plugin and install-deck-plugin.bat).
- Extract the zip and double-click install-deck-plugin.bat.
- Open Stream Deck and look for RGBJunkie in the action list.
Requires Stream Deck 6.4+ and a current RGBJunkie build with rgbjunkie:// links registered.
What you can assign
| Action | What it does |
|---|---|
| RGBJunkie Effect | Pick an effect and optional canvas tab target |
| Previous / Next Effect | Step through your effect list (per canvas tab if you choose one) |
| RGBJunkie Scene | Load a saved Scene |
| Previous / Next Scene | Step through user Scenes only (skips internal data files) |
| Toggle Lights | Pause the effect and black out all device LEDs; press again to restore |
| Brightness Up / Down | Step master brightness ±5% |
| Master Brightness (Dial) | Stream Deck + only — rotate to dim/brighten; press dial for 100% |
| Cycle Effect / Scene (Dial) | Rotate to step effects or Scenes |
| Pause + Brightness (Dial) | Press to pause; rotate for brightness |
| Effect Browser, Hardware, Installed, Logs, Plugins folder, Restart | Open app views or folders |
Most actions use silent mode so RGBJunkie stays in the tray.
Canvas tab targeting
For Effect and Previous/Next Effect, the property inspector can target:
- Selected canvas — whichever canvas tab is active in RGBJunkie
- A specific canvas tab — control a background tab without switching to it in the app
Same links from shortcuts
Stream Deck uses the same rgbjunkie:// URLs documented in App links and on Documentation → App deep links. You can test links from a browser or batch file when debugging.
